OTTENS, LARGE ENGRAVED WALL MAP OF EUROPE, [EARLY EIGHTEENTH CENTURY]

Estimate
2,000 - 3,000 GBP
bidding is closed

Description

  • Europa. [Amsterdam: Reiner and Joshua Ottens, early eighteenth century]
1100 x 1300mm., large engraved wall map on six sheets joined, contemporary hand-colour, elaborate vignettes, backed on linen, old folds and a few minor tears

Catalogue Note

Apparently a later edition of Frederick de Wit's monumental wall map Nova et Accurata Totius Europae Tabula, with the imprint of R. & J. Ottens and without side panels.
